Analysis

The most recent figure for new or unknown treatment history cases: pulmonary, bacteriologically in Colombia is 14,524,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 11 years on record.

The figure is up 28.9% on the previous year and up 107.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, new or unknown treatment history cases: pulmonary, bacteriologically in Colombia peaked at 14,524 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 6,944, in 2020.

That places Colombia 32nd out of 197 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.

New or unknown treatment history cases: Pulmonary, bacteriologically in Colombia, year by year

Annual values for New or unknown treatment history cases: Pulmonary, bacteriologically confirmed in Colombia, 2013 to 2023.
Year Value Change
2013 6,996
2014 7,287 +4.2%
2015 7,521 +3.2%
2016 7,973 +6.0%
2017 8,329 +4.5%
2018 8,569 +2.9%
2019 9,387 +9.5%
2020 6,944 -26.0%
2021 8,256 +18.9%
2022 11,265 +36.4%
2023 14,524 +28.9%
